作者:Waylon
作者简介:小白一枚,和大多数同学一样从零开始一步步学习,一步步积累。期待您的关注,让我们一起成长~注:本人学疏才浅,如有错误之处,还有望指出~项目功能简介:用户输入所有的观众名称,点击立即抽奖,即可获得一位幸运观众并将获奖信息显示出来;点击EXIT可退出程序。
实现思路
1.创建窗体:用来显示在屏幕上和存放各种组件
2.创建一个文本框:用来实现用户的输入
3.创建两个多行文本域:用来显示观众信息和抽奖结果信息
4.创建两个按钮:用来开始抽奖和退出程序
所需技术
本实例中的重点,是把字符串中的人员名单分割为数组,以及随机生成数组下标索引,这分别需要用到String类的spilt()方法和Math类的random()方法。
实现过程
1.创建窗体
关键代码如下:
public class Demo extends JFrame {
/**
* 创建窗体
*/
public Demo() {
setTitle("随机抽取幸运观众");
set